Dartmouth College

Hanover, NH

Our analysis found Dartmouth College to be the most popular school for mathematics students who want to pursue a master’s degree in New Hampshire. Dartmouth is a medium-sized private not-for-profit school located in the remote town of Hanover.

Of the 8 students majoring in math at Dartmouth, 63% are male and 38% are female.

Rivier University

Nashua, NH

The in-demand master’s degree programs at Rivier University helped the school earn the #3 place on this year’s ranking of the most popular mathematics schools in New Hampshire. Located in the small city of Nashua, Rivier is a private not-for-profit college with a small student population.
